What this skill tells your AI

The instructions your AI receives, as published by jabrena/plinth in skills/414-frameworks-quarkus-kafka/SKILL.md and read by ahel’s review.

Apply Quarkus Kafka guidance with concrete examples for design, implementation, and error handling.

Constraints

Compile before messaging refactors; verify after changes.

  • MANDATORY: Run ./mvnw compile or mvn compile before applying any change
  • SAFETY: If compilation fails, stop immediately
  • VERIFY: Run ./mvnw clean verify or mvn clean verify after applying improvements
  • BEFORE APPLYING: Read the reference for detailed rules and examples

When to use this skill

  • Add Kafka in Quarkus
  • Review Quarkus Reactive Messaging consumers/producers
  • Improve retries, dead-letter handling, or idempotency in Quarkus Kafka
  • Configure Quarkus Reactive Messaging Kafka channels
  • Add Quarkus Kafka failure strategy or DLQ handling

Workflow

  1. Read reference and assess project context

Read references/414-frameworks-quarkus-kafka.md and inspect current messaging setup before proposing changes.

  1. Gather scope and decide target improvements

Identify delivery semantics and resilience goals to define safe improvements.

  1. Apply framework-aligned changes

Implement/refactor channels, serializers, and failure strategies in Reactive Messaging.

  1. Run verification and report results

Execute build/tests and summarize what changed, what was verified, and follow-up actions.
